Russia launches language TV quiz for foreigners


13.01.2021

Photo credit: ru.wikipedia.org

The TV quiz on the knowledge of the Russian language for foreigners, who study or work in Russia, will be aired on the MIR TV channel. Participants will answer questions and complete tasks together with the famous TV presenter Anton Komolov, according to MK.

In addition to knowledge of the grammar of the Russian language, the participants will have to show erudition in the history of Russia and the etymology of catchphrases, as well as demonstrate quick-wittedness and a sense of humor. According to the presenter, it will be interesting for viewers to follow the intense and gambling struggle of the participants.

Also, the TV game will feature interesting stories of foreigners living in Russia. Guests will talk about what stereotypes about the country turned out to be false, about their travels in Russia and getting to know its inhabitants.

The first episode will bring together the British and the team, which includes a Frenchman and a guest from Canada.

Italian entrepreneur Marco Maggi's book, "Russian to the Bone," is now accessible for purchase in Italy and is scheduled for release in Russia in the upcoming months. In the book, Marco recounts his personal odyssey, narrating each stage of his life as a foreigner in Russia—starting from the initial fascination to the process of cultural assimilation, venturing into business, fostering authentic friendships, and ultimately, reaching a deep sense of identifying as a Russian at his very core.
